◆ __BKPT
      
        
          | #define __BKPT | 
          ( | 
            | 
          value | ) | 
             __ASM volatile ("bkpt "#value) | 
        
      
 
Breakpoint. 
Causes the processor to enter Debug state. Debug tools can use this to investigate system state when the instruction at a particular address is reached. 
- Parameters
 - 
  
    | [in] | value | is ignored by the processor. If required, a debugger can use it to store additional information about the breakpoint.  | 
  
   
 
 
◆ __CLZ
      
        
          | #define __CLZ   __builtin_clz | 
        
      
 
Count leading zeros. 
Counts the number of leading zeros of a data value. 
- Parameters
 - 
  
    | [in] | value | Value to count the leading zeros  | 
  
   
- Returns
 - number of leading zeros in value
